ProcedureEdit

  • A “Patta” is a legal document issued by the respective state government in the name of the actual owner of the property.


Apply In-Person:

  1. Those who are interested in getting an extract of land record (patta) shall approach the respective office of the “Mamlatdar” within their jurisdiction where the property is situated.
  2. contact link
  3. Please go to the respective office. Consult with the designated authority about the applying procedure for getting an extract of land record(patta).
  4. Collect the application form or write on a plain A4 sheet as advised.
  5. Complete the application form. Attach the entire required documents as per our “Required Documents” section of this page and submit it to the designated receiving authority as advised.
  6. After receiving the application, authorities will check the submitted application and document set. If all are in place, the application will be accepted. Please pay the fees/charges if applicable and don’t forget to take the receipt.
  7. Authorities will make entries about this application in the manual record or electronically using the computer. A record number will be given as acknowledgement for receipt of the application form. Please collect it and keep it safe for future reference.
  8. Applicant will be informed of the probable date of getting the extract of land record(patta).
  9. This application will be processed further. Concerned authorities will verify the land details.
  10. Once the matching records are found, a printout of the extract from the town survey land register will be sent to the respective sanctioning department.
  11. Concerned sanctioning authority will approve the extract with seal and signature as per the format applicable.
  12. The status will be conveyed to the applicant through an “SMS”.
  13. Applicant shall revisit the office where they applied for this procedure to get the “patta”, or it will be delivered as per applicable norms.

Apply Online:

  1. The applicant need to visit the website Link: link
  2. The applicant need to fill in the form in the website.
  3. The application form requires the details regarding Taluka, village, survey number, subdivision number.
  4. After entering the details the applicant need to enter the captacha given below.
  5. Once completed, the applicant need to click “submit” button at the bottom of the page.
  6. Once submitted, the applicant can view the land records at the bottom of the same page.

Required DocumentsEdit

  • Application form
  • Applicant’s Residence proof (Ration card / Aadhaar card / Telephone bill / Bank passbook)
  • Applicant’s Identity proof (Passport / Aadhaar card / Voter ID / Driving licence)
  • Copy of property documents (sale deed)
  • Property tax payment receipt
  • Proof of possession, such as the tax receipt or electricity bill
  • Encumbrance certificate
  • Ration card
  • Aadhaar card

EligibilityEdit

  • When a land is sold, the buyer is eligible to apply for an extract of land record(patta).
  • A seller, who intends to sell his/her land, is eligible to apply for an extract of land record(patta).
  • Applicant should have the valid land details (survey number, plot number, etc) to apply.
  • Landowners are eligible to apply.
  • Any individual, who is in need of such records, is eligible to apply.

Need for the DocumentEdit

  • The extract of land record (patta) endorses the real owner of a land.
  • The extract of land record(patta) is beneficial to detect false claim on the lands.
  • The extract of land record (patta) can be used in court litigations related to property.
  • The extract of land record (patta) is needed for several things such as obtaining bank loans, selling properties, creating partition deeds, etc.



Information which might helpEdit

  • A “Patta” is a legal and important document which acts as a revenue record of the specific piece of land.
  • The “patta” will include:
    • Locational details of the immovable property.
    • Circle.
    • Village.
    • Patta number.
    • Name of the revenue circle.
    • Owner name.
    • Land area details.
